diff options
author | Ronan Pigott <rpigott@berkeley.edu> | 2019-11-04 15:10:40 -0700 |
---|---|---|
committer | Brian Ashworth <bosrsf04@gmail.com> | 2019-11-04 21:16:27 -0500 |
commit | 3975ca28c2e870eb3f40bbd43a90354743f7ccf1 (patch) | |
tree | d35aa9aa8b0c17e94fb24359a13ab83547cafae5 /sway/commands/hide_edge_borders.c | |
parent | Add --custom to `output mode` command (diff) | |
download | sway-3975ca28c2e870eb3f40bbd43a90354743f7ccf1.tar.gz sway-3975ca28c2e870eb3f40bbd43a90354743f7ccf1.tar.zst sway-3975ca28c2e870eb3f40bbd43a90354743f7ccf1.zip |
smart_borders: separate smartness from edge types
Diffstat (limited to 'sway/commands/hide_edge_borders.c')
-rw-r--r-- | sway/commands/hide_edge_borders.c | 7 |
1 files changed, 4 insertions, 3 deletions
diff --git a/sway/commands/hide_edge_borders.c b/sway/commands/hide_edge_borders.c index f69bece1..9a1d8445 100644 --- a/sway/commands/hide_edge_borders.c +++ b/sway/commands/hide_edge_borders.c | |||
@@ -32,14 +32,15 @@ struct cmd_results *cmd_hide_edge_borders(int argc, char **argv) { | |||
32 | } else if (strcmp(argv[0], "both") == 0) { | 32 | } else if (strcmp(argv[0], "both") == 0) { |
33 | config->hide_edge_borders = E_BOTH; | 33 | config->hide_edge_borders = E_BOTH; |
34 | } else if (strcmp(argv[0], "smart") == 0) { | 34 | } else if (strcmp(argv[0], "smart") == 0) { |
35 | config->hide_edge_borders = E_SMART; | 35 | config->hide_edge_borders = E_NONE; |
36 | config->hide_edge_borders_smart = ESMART_ON; | ||
36 | } else if (strcmp(argv[0], "smart_no_gaps") == 0) { | 37 | } else if (strcmp(argv[0], "smart_no_gaps") == 0) { |
37 | config->hide_edge_borders = E_SMART_NO_GAPS; | 38 | config->hide_edge_borders = E_NONE; |
39 | config->hide_edge_borders_smart = ESMART_NO_GAPS; | ||
38 | } else { | 40 | } else { |
39 | return cmd_results_new(CMD_INVALID, expected_syntax); | 41 | return cmd_results_new(CMD_INVALID, expected_syntax); |
40 | } | 42 | } |
41 | config->hide_lone_tab = hide_lone_tab; | 43 | config->hide_lone_tab = hide_lone_tab; |
42 | config->saved_edge_borders = config->hide_edge_borders; | ||
43 | 44 | ||
44 | arrange_root(); | 45 | arrange_root(); |
45 | 46 | ||